US Congresswoman Ilhan Omar has broken her silence after she was sprayed with an unknown substance during a town hall event in Minneapolis. The city has seen tensions rise significantly in recent weeks after immigration agents fatally shot an intensive care nurse and a mother of three.

Speaking prior to the incident , Ms Omar, who has been the victim of racial slurs and derogatory remarks from President Trump and his supporters, called for the abolishment of US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E). She also told attendees that Homeland Security Secretary Kristi Noem should resign, stating that “ICE cannot be reformed.” After being approached at the lectern by a man wearing a black jacket, Ms Omar turned to face him and moved towards him with her arm raised, seemingly not cowered.

The audience cheered as the man was pinned down and his arms were tied behind his back.

In video footage of the incident, someone in the crowd can be heard saying: “Oh my God, he sprayed something on her.”

Ms Omar continued the event after the man was ushered out of the room.

Speaking after the incident, the congresswoman’s office issued a statement, confirming that Ms Omar was sprayed “with a syringe.”

It read: “During her town hall, an agitator tried to attack the Congresswoman by spraying an unknown substance with a syringe. Security and the Minneapolis Police Department quickly apprehended the individual. He is now in custody.

“The Congresswoman is okay. She continued with her town hall because she doesn’t let bullies win.”

Ms Omar added on X: "I'm ok. I’m a survivor so this small agitator isn’t going to intimidate me from doing my work.

“I don’t let bullies win. Grateful to my incredible constituents who rallied behind me. Minnesota strong.”
